On this day, May 23, 1954, negotiations between the big banana monopolies, the Honduran government, and striking agricultural workers began after weeks of coordinated national resistance. The general strike was the most significant popular uprising in Honduras in the 20th century

New: Trump’s OMB director, proving influential in GOP debt talks, wants to avoid Medicare/SS but is pushing to pulverize programs for the poor
His budget calls for:
- $2T cuts to Medicaid
- $600B cuts to ACA
- $400B food stamps cut
- Halve head start
